Plausibility of potassium ion-exchanged zsm-5 as soot combustion catalysts

英文摘要Potassium (k) ion-exchanged zsm-5 zeolites were investigated for catalytic soot combustion. x-ray absorption fine-structure (xafs), raman, in situ ir and nh3-temperature programmed desorption (nh3-tpd) confirmed the location of k+ at the ion-exchanged sites. temperature-programmed oxidation (tpo) reactions showed that k-zsm-5 decreased ignition tempeatures of soot combustion and increased selectivity to co2. the improved activity for soot combustion by increasing k+-exchanged amounts via decreasing the si/al ratio reinforced the k+ ions participating in soot combustion. o-18(2) isotopic isothermal reactions suggested the activation of gaseous oxygen by the k+ ions. this demonstrated a new appliction of alkali metal exchanged zeolites and the strategy for enhancement of catalytic soot combustion activity.
